Two young Manchester City hooligans with respectable jobs have escaped jail for taking part in a brawl with French rivals before a Champions League fixture.
George Sykes, 21, from Bury, who serves in the Royal Navy, and swimming pool engineer Adam Needham, 22, from Stockport, joined a group of City thugs who attacked supporters of the French club Lyon before the match at the Etihad stadium on September 19,
